Braised Pork over Rice (Rou Zhao)

- Meat
- 2 lb pork belly (diced)
- 2 lb pork shoulder (diced)
- 6 shallots (chopped)
- 3 garlic cloves (chopped)
- 1 Tbsp cane sugar
- 1 tsp ginger (minced)
- Sauce
- 3/4 cup soy sauce
- 1/4 cup rice wine
- 1/4 tsp five spice
- 2 whole star anise
- 1 cinnamon stick
- 1 tsp pepper
- 1 cup fried shallots
- 3-4 cups water
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 300F
- Blanch the diced pork (2 minutes)
- Heat sugar and oil and saute the pork (10 minutes)
- Add the shallots and garlic (5 minutes)
- Add soy sauce, five spice, rice wine, star anise, cinnamon, and pepper (10 minutes)
- Add in fried shallots and water
- Bake for 2.5 hours at 300F
- Move to stovetop and boil on medium for 30 minutes
- Serve over rice. Top with green onions
